Highest-paid coaches in college football
It would be pretty sweet to be University of Florida football coach Urban Meyer.
On Monday, Florida gave Meyer, who has won two BCS Championships in the past three years, a raise and a new six-year contract. He now receives $4 million annually, making him the highest-paid coach in the Southeastern Conference.
